The recognition of certificates and qualifications of late repatriates in Bavaria for agricultural professions without training courses in the higher education sector must be applied for.
This form can be submitted electronically (e.g. via a secure contact form using your user account with login via the electronic ID function or the ELSTER certificate) or handwritten and signed in paper form to the responsible authority.
According to § 10 Para. 1 of the Federal Expellees Act (BVFG), examinations and certificates of qualification that ethnic German repatriates took or acquired up to 8 May 1945 in the territory of the German Reich according to the territorial status as of 31 December 1937 are to be recognized.
Pursuant to § 10 Para. 2 BVFG, examinations and certificates of qualification that ethnic German repatriates have taken or acquired in the resettlement areas are to be recognized if they are equivalent to the corresponding examinations or certificates of qualification in the area of application of the Basic Law.
Pursuant to § 7 para. 2 BVFG, § 10 shall also apply mutatis mutandis to the spouse and descendants of ethnic German repatriates who do not meet the requirements of § 4 para. 1 or 2 BVFG but who have left the resettlement areas by way of the admission procedure.
You can have the equivalence of foreign (non-academic) agricultural vocational training with a comparable German occupation (e.g. farmer, animal farmer, gardener, housekeeper) confirmed.
